Learn more about Jispa

Nestled along the Bhaga River, this Himalayan village offers peaceful riverside walks and traditional Lahauli culture in its ancient Buddhist monastery. Trek to nearby Shingo La Pass or arrange jeep tours to explore the dramatic mountain landscapes of Spiti Valley.

  • Shashur Monastery: Located 12.9km from Jispa, this serene monastery offers a unique glimpse into Tibetan Buddhism and local culture. Surrounded by stunning landscapes, it provides a peaceful environment for reflection and exploration of beautiful murals and ancient artifacts.
  • Rohtang Pass: Situated 112.9km from Jispa, Rohtang Pass is a breathtaking mountain destination perfect for outdoor enthusiasts. Experience thrilling adventures like trekking and photography against the backdrop of snow-capped peaks and lush valleys.
  • Solang Valley: About 33.8km from Jispa, this ski resort is an adventure lover's paradise. Offering skiing, paragliding, and other outdoor activities, Solang Valley is a must-visit for adrenaline seekers and nature admirers alike.
